Join a high-performing development team in the City, representing one of the biggest and most revered brokers in the global insurance market, targeting the mid-market and corporate space. This team is delivering exceptional results. Individuals here are consistently earning between £150k and £250k annually - there's no cap on bonus, and no ceiling on what you can achieve.

The brand and market reputation opens doors and the levels of service, product and proposition will empower you to win. If you're looking for the next step in your development career in the London insurance market, this is an opportunity to build something significant and be rewarded accordingly.

What’s in it for you:

  • Earning potential - base salary from £60,000–£100,000 with an open-ended bonus. Top earners are exceeding £250,000.
  • No restrictions - on deal size or sector. You'll have the freedom to pursue the opportunities that fit your network, knowledge and experience, be that general commercial or specialty.
  • Credibility – the business’s market presence gets you through the door. Your expertise and that of your colleagues closes the deal.
  • Support - expert broking, placement, marketing and client service teams around you and your clients.
  • Career momentum - a step up for experienced new business developers who want to elevate their career and income.
  • Real flexibility - based in the City, but with the autonomy to spend your time where you’ll have the most impact.
  • Long-term rewards - 10% pension, BUPA private medical and dental, share save scheme, critical illness cover, life assurance, sabbaticals and extra holiday linked to tenure.

Why this team?

  • It’s high performing – you’ll join a team well ahead of target, with serious momentum.
  • It’s trusted – clients want to work with this firm. Brand strength and client outcomes drive inbound interest.
  • It’s ambitious – you’ll be encouraged to think big, with no artificial limits on growth or income.
  • It’s modern – the function is sophisticated, data-driven, and built for high performance.
  • It’s strategic – deals are often long-term and relationship-based, not transactional.

Who this is for:

You have a track record of business development in the insurance sector. You know how to build relationships, navigate complex sales, and win the right kind of clients. You want to be in a business that matches your drive and professionalism – where effort is rewarded, and where you’re supported, not constrained.

If you're ready for a career move where your results will speak for themselves — and be rewarded accordingly — we’d like to hear from you.
